Dynamic synthetic inertial control method of wind turbines considering fatigue load

HIGHLIGHTS

  • who: . and collaborators from the Northeast Electric Power University, China have published the research: Dynamic synthetic inertial control method of wind turbines considering fatigue load, in the Journal: (JOURNAL)
  • what: The study showed the following: 1) both the droop and virtual inertia methods can expose the shaft of a wind generator to forces capable of stimulating its natural resonance frequencies.
